THE AFL has today announced the 2024 Toyota AFL Grand Final on Saturday, September 28 at the MCG will begin in its traditional time slot of 2:30pm AEST.

AFL Chief Executive Officer Andrew Dillon said the AFL Commission signed off on the recommendation in his CEO report presented at the Commission meeting in Melbourne today.

While there was an acknowledgement of the great presentation of a Saturday twilight event, especially across some marquee games in that timeslot during this year’s home and away season, there was a collective view that the Toyota AFL Grand Final should remain in its traditional slot for 2024.

The Commission will continue to review the start time for future Grand Finals.

Local start times by each State / Territory:

AEST 2:30pm – ACT, NSW, QLD, TAS, VIC
AWST 12:30pm – WA
ACST 2:00pm – NT, SA
